Build a Generative AI Toolkit to Stay Ahead at Work
How to Build Your Own Generative AI Toolkit to Stay Ahead at Work
In today's fast-paced technological landscape, staying ahead in the workplace requires embracing the latest advancements in artificial intelligence, particularly generative AI. As of 2025, generative AI tools have become indispensable for automating tasks, enhancing creativity, and streamlining workflows. Whether you're a developer, content creator, or business leader, understanding how to build and integrate your own generative AI toolkit is crucial for leveraging these benefits. Let's dive into the world of generative AI, explore its applications, and guide you through the process of constructing your own toolkit.
Introduction to Generative AI
Generative AI models are trained on vast datasets to learn patterns and relationships within text, images, audio, or code. This training enables them to generate new outputs that mimic the training data, creating realistic and original content. Some of the top generative AI tools in 2025 include Jasper for content creation, ChatGPT for conversational AI, and DALL-E 3 for image generation[3][4][5].
Key Components of a Generative AI Toolkit
Building a comprehensive generative AI toolkit involves several key components:
Machine Learning Frameworks: Tools like TensorFlow or PyTorch are essential for developing and training AI models. These frameworks provide the infrastructure needed to build custom models tailored to specific tasks.
Generative AI Models: Models such as GPT-4 for text generation or DALL-E 3 for image creation are crucial for generating new content. These models are trained on large datasets and can produce high-quality outputs.
Data Sources: Access to diverse and high-quality datasets is vital for training models. This includes text, images, audio, or other forms of data relevant to your specific application.
Integration Tools: APIs and software development kits (SDKs) are necessary for integrating AI models into existing workflows or applications.
Steps to Build Your Own Generative AI Toolkit
Step 1: Choose Your Tools
- Identify Needs: Determine what tasks you want to automate or enhance with generative AI.
- Select Frameworks: Choose appropriate machine learning frameworks like TensorFlow or PyTorch.
- Select Models: Decide on the generative models that best fit your needs, such as GPT-4 for text or DALL-E 3 for images.
Step 2: Gather Data
- Data Collection: Gather high-quality datasets relevant to your application.
- Data Preprocessing: Clean and preprocess the data to ensure it is suitable for training.
Step 3: Train Your Models
- Model Training: Use your chosen frameworks to train your selected models on the collected data.
- Model Tuning: Fine-tune the models to optimize performance for your specific tasks.
Step 4: Integrate the Toolkit
- API Integration: Use APIs to integrate your trained models into existing applications or workflows.
- User Interface Development: Create user-friendly interfaces to interact with your generative AI tools.
Real-World Applications and Examples
Generative AI has numerous real-world applications:
- Content Creation: Tools like Jasper are used to generate high-quality content such as blog posts and marketing materials.
- Image Generation: DALL-E 3 is used for creating realistic images from text prompts.
- Conversational AI: ChatGPT is utilized for developing chatbots that can engage in natural conversations.
Future Implications and Potential Outcomes
As we look to the future, generative AI will continue to evolve, offering more sophisticated tools for automation and creativity. However, it also raises questions about ethics, privacy, and job displacement. As industries adapt to these changes, the ability to build and customize your own generative AI toolkit will become increasingly valuable.
Conclusion
Building a generative AI toolkit is a strategic move for anyone looking to leverage the power of AI in their work. By understanding the key components, choosing the right tools, and integrating them effectively, you can enhance productivity, creativity, and innovation. As generative AI continues to advance, staying ahead means embracing these technologies and adapting them to your unique needs.
Excerpt: "Stay ahead in the workplace by building your own generative AI toolkit, enhancing productivity and creativity with the latest AI tools."
Tags: generative-ai, machine-learning, OpenAI, Nvidia, AI-ethics, llm-training, natural-language-processing
Category: applications/industry - generative-ai